Nebraska man makes 60 naked skydiving jumps in 24 hours

(UPI) A Nebraska man set a new world record by completing 60 skydiving jumps in 24 hours while dressed in nothing but his safety equipment.

Rian Kanouff of Omaha said he contacted Guinness World Records about setting the record for most naked skydiving jumps in 24 hours, and the group said he could create the new record category if he performed at least 25 jumps in the time period.

Kanouff said its an informal tradition for skydivers to perform their 100th jump in the nude, and he came up with the idea to set the naked skydiving world record as a fundraiser for a mental health charity after the recent death of a friend.

 

"My friend that we lost to mental health issues was about [that] close to his 100th jump," Kanouff told KOLN-TV. Close enough that he talked about it all the time, and he didn't get to make it. So I am out here for him and a lot of other people that we lost.

Kanouff ended his attempt with 60 completed naked jumps over Weeping Water, Neb. His attempt raised money for the Movember Foundation, a charity dedicated to men's mental health and suicide prevention.
